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We’ll conduct a thorough assessment of the damage to determine the extent of the water damage and identify any underlying issues that may have caused the problem. Our team will then develop a customized plan to restore your property to its former condition.

Step 2: Drying and Dehumidification

Our technicians will use advanced equipment, including industrial fans and dehumidifiers, to dry and dehumidify the affected area.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and promoting a safe and healthy environment.

Step 3: Repairs and Replacements

Once the area is dry and dehumidified, our team will make any necessary repairs or replacements to ensure your property is safe and secure. This may include fixing damaged drywall, replacing flooring or ceilings, or addressing any underlying issues that may have caused the water damage.

Step 4: Final Inspection and Cleaning

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that the repair has been completed to our high standards. We’ll also clean and disinfect the affected area to prevent any potential health risks.

Ceiling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water stain on ceiling Yes No DIY fixes are usually simple and effective for small stains.
Water damage from burst pipe No Yes Water damage from a burst pipe requires spec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and health risks.
Musty odors in attic No Yes Musty odors in the attic can be a sign of mold growth or water damage, which requires professional attention to prevent further damage and health risks.
Warped flooring in basement No Yes Warped flooring in the basement can be a sign of water damage or moisture issues, which requires professional attention to prevent further damage and safety risks.
Small leak under sink Yes No DIY fixes are usually simple and effective for small leaks under the sink.
Water damage from roof leak No Yes Water damage from a roof leak requires spec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and health risks.

Ceiling Water Damage Repair Cost in Willard, UT

The cost of ceiling water damage repair can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ions in Willard, UT.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Drying and Dehumidification $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Repairs and Replacements $1,000 – $5,000 Scope of repairs, materials needed, and labor costs.
Final Inspection and Cleaning $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and complexity of repairs.
Water Damage Assessment $100 – $500 Size of affected area and complexity of damage.
Mold Remediation $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of mold growth, and equipment needed.
Structural Repairs $1,500 – $10,000 Scope of repairs, materials needed, and labor costs.

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ment by one of our technicians. We offer free estimates and are happy to answer any questions you may have.
